Mereni (Hungarian: Kézdialmás, Hungarian pronunciation: [ˈkeːzdiɒlmaːʃ]) is a commune in Covasna County, Transylvania, Romania composed of two villages:
The commune has an absolute Székely Hungarian majority. According to the 2011 census, it has a population of 1,312, of which 98.78% or 1,296 are Hungarian.
